Full description from employer

PRIMARY FUNCTION: The Shipping Superintendent partners with the Shipping Manager to oversee the shipping department through supervisory staff to ensure product is stored safely, is dispatched to customers as required, and all procedures are followed in compliance with Company policies (i.e. SOPs, GMPs, etc.) and Federal and State regulations (i.e. USDA, OSHA, etc.) while achieving the highest level of productivity.

RESPONSIBILITIES AND TASKS:    
•    Manage department though supervisors following established procedures adjusting as necessary to meet shipping schedules, increase efficiencies, and meet or exceed budget objectives 
•    Oversee the day-to-day departmental activities to ensure efficient transportation and storage of materials used and produced by production lines and the safe and efficient loading and unloading of product to reduce risk of contamination and damage
•    Review department, docks, and storage facilities to ensure they are organized and maintained according to guidelines/procedures
•    Gather, compile, and create required reports communicating bottlenecks, issues, and other risks to product and shipping schedules to appropriate personnel
•    Mentor, coach and train/ cross-train employees encouraging career development; provide consistent feedback concerning strengths and areas in need of improvement
•    Administer performance improvement plans and disciplinary actions on a fair and consistent basis 
•    Identify opportunities for improvement, present to appropriate leader, and implement, lead or participate in solution implementation
•    Wear personal protective equipment (PPE) in all areas where mandatory helping to promote a zero-accident culture
•    Perform additional relevant duties as assigned 

SUPERVISORY ROLE: 
•    This role is a Leader of Leaders role with required competencies:  Sizing up People, Delegation, Planning, Customer Focus and Conflict Management

EDUCATION and CERTIFICATIONS: 
•    High School diploma or equivalent; Associate degree with relevant coursework from an accredited institution preferred
 

EXPERIENCE AND SKILLS:
•    Minimum four (4) years relevant in a supply chain or shipping environment; experience in perishable foods preferred 
•    Demonstrated leadership experience including knowledge of timekeeping requirements, policy adherence, conflict resolution and the ability to resolve issues efficiently and effectively; previous supervisory experience preferred
•    Strong computer literacy (Microsoft Excel, Word and Outlook)
•    Must have good communication skills, both verbal and written, with the ability to communicate with all levels of the organization in a timely and professional manner; multi-lingual strongly preferred
•    Ability to handle and resolve most issues in an efficient and effective manner while ensuring confidential information is relayed only on a need-to-know basis
•    Excellent organizational skills with the ability to prioritize projects, planning skills, and a high attention to detail
•    Must possess a strong customer-centric attitude, high energy level and a strong sense of urgency

SAFETY REQUIREMENTS:
•    Follow and ensure others follow departmental and company safety policies and programs
•    Wear required protective equipment in all areas where mandatory

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:
•    Ability to work extended shifts (holiday, weekend and/or extended) as business need requires
•    Ability to work in cold/ humid or hot/ dusty environments as needed
•    Ability to move throughout the shipping department throughout the entire shift
•    Ability to lift 50 lbs as needed
